Characteristics of vinyl and acrylic. How do they affect the quality of siding

Largely performance characteristics siding determines the material of its foundation. In our case, vinyl and acrylic. However, it should immediately be said that good siding has not been made uniform in composition for a long time by monoextrusion, that is, pushing the molten mass through an extruder. Modern technologies make it possible to make siding two-layer: the lower layer provides mechanical strength, and the upper one has both a protective and decorative function. Therefore, there is equipment that makes it possible to obtain two-layer sheets bonded at the molecular level from the melts of two components. This process is called co-extrusion. And this technology is used to get the vast majority of siding.

Considering the multi-layer construction of the siding and the presence of many modifiers, dyes, stabilizers and other additives in its composition, it can be stated that one hundred percent "racial" purity of vinyl and acrylic siding does not exist in principle. We can only say that these materials form its basis and determine its properties.

Polyvinyl chloride (PVC, vinyl,PVC)

The most common is vinyl siding. It owes its name to its main component, which makes up more than 80% of its composition. This is nothing more than polyvinyl chloride (PVC) - one of the types of plastics that has found the widest application among its "brothers" in the class. Russian name This material is PVC, and in the rest of the world it is called PVC.

Polyvinyl chloride is a wonderful material and is the best suited for finishing. More than 60% of vinyl produced in the world is used specifically in construction - for the production of siding, finishing panels, window and door profiles, window sills and other products. Such a demand for polyvinyl chloride is easily explained, since with a relatively cheap manufacturing process, PVC has a number of good properties:

  • PVC has high mechanical strength, wear resistance, rigidity. Moreover, all these qualities are combined with a low specific gravity (density), which is 1.35-1.43 g / cm³.
  • Vinyl is weather resistant. All naturally occurring solvents, the main of which is water, have no effect on it. PVC does not "know" what corrosion and biological damage are.
  • The temperature resistance of polyvinyl chloride is also on top. Pure, without any additives, PVC can be used for a long time at a temperature of 60°C. it begins to melt at a temperature of 150-200°C, and begins to burn only at 500°C. Moreover, after the source of high temperature disappears, the combustion immediately stops. In other words, PVC does not support combustion.
  • PVC is a very good dielectric, and it is not for nothing that it is widely used for insulation in cable and wire products. The same property is very useful in finishing materials, the ability to conduct electric current is simply inappropriate here.
  • Vinyl building materials compare favorably with their durability.
  • PVC is very easy to process with a simple tool.

It is known that ideal materials do not exist, and PVC has weak spots that need to be taken into account:

  • When PVC is heated to temperatures up to 100°C, it begins to decompose and release into ambient air hydrogen chloride HCl, known to us as hydrochloric acid. This can lead to irritation of the upper respiratory tract and mucous membranes of the eyes. But under standard operating conditions, such a temperature can appear only in extraordinary cases.
  • At low temperatures PVC becomes more brittle, but almost all building materials have this unpleasant property. The main thing is that low temperature does not cause degradation of the material.
  • The main disadvantage of vinyl is photodegradation when exposed to ultraviolet light. With prolonged exposure to direct sunlight, high-energy photons of ultraviolet light break down PVC molecules. This phenomenon is fought and quite successfully with the help of special additives. In its pure form, polyvinyl chloride is almost never used. It is always “customized” for the desired application by adding various ingredients to the composition. What is added to vinyl siding?

  • First of all, this is actually polyvinyl chloride itself, which makes up about 80% in the finished siding. But he is different. It is best if only primary raw materials are used for production, but in reality this is far from the case. AT chemical industry widely used secondary raw materials, which are obtained by processing products that have already been in use. This noble mission contributes to the preservation of the environment, but does nothing to improve the quality of PVC siding. The best manufacturers add no more than 5% recycled PVC to their products and honestly report it, while some other unscrupulous manufacturers can “sin” with a large percentage of gray-back PVC (recycled PVC) and not tell the buyer anything about it. In appearance, this difference can not always be determined. Therefore, it is worth buying only siding from a good, honest manufacturer from no less good and honest sellers.
  • Titanium dioxide is also the most common additive in vinyl siding. This compound is also called titanium white, and also as a food additive E171. It is added only to the top layer during the co-extrusion process and serves to give stability to the top layer, preventing damage by UV rays. As a result, the color of the siding is less prone to fading. But titanium dioxide works only with light and soft tones of the siding color, more expensive chemical compounds are used on brighter and darker ones. The top layer contains no more than 10% titanium dioxide.

Titanium white or titanium dioxide - an indispensable additive in the top layer of light-colored siding

  • Calcium carbonate - this compound is always used in the production of plastics, especially PVC. This component is introduced into the lower layer, and it is from 10 to 15% of its composition. It is a filler and in addition contributes to the uniform coloring of PVC throughout the volume.
  • Butadiene is a compound found in PVC used in siding. Its content is no more than 1%, but even such a small proportion makes it possible to stabilize PVC, and most importantly, to increase its elasticity and wear resistance. To be precise and honest, butadiene is not included in its pure form, since it is a gas. Styrene-butadiene thermoplastics are used, which are added to polyvinyl chloride. The same compound is necessarily used for the production of high-quality synthetic rubbers and road bitumen, which retain their elasticity over a wide temperature range.

  • Various modifiers that improve the impact resistance of the siding are also introduced into its composition. Their share is very small, but they significantly add strength properties. The specific chemical composition and content of these modifiers are the know-how of manufacturing companies and, for obvious reasons, are not disclosed.
  • To paint the siding in the desired colors, concentrated pigments are introduced into it, which should give desired color and shade, while still being resistant to fading from exposure to UV rays. Of course, their composition is also the intellectual property of the manufacturer and is not subject to publication.
  • Good siding is never glossy. Therefore, in the process of its production, matting additives are always added to the top layer, which remove the original gloss.
  • Antistatic additives are also required, since the properties of dielectrics are known to accumulate static electricity. Few people will be pleased to receive an electric discharge from the walls of their home.

Acrylic and its derivatives used for the production of siding

The concept of acrylic is very broad and it includes a very large group synthetic materials both solid and liquid. For the first time, under the concept of acrylic, a fabric made of acrylic fiber appeared, and then various polymers began to appear. This title was "kindly shared" acrylic acid, which has chemical formula CH 2 \u003d CH-COOH. Based on this compound and others, very a large number of fibers, polymers in liquid and solid form. In order not to delve into the jungle of chemical synthesis, since most readers will still not understand anything, let's say that the material from which siding is made is called acrylic-styrene-acrylonitrile in the strict language of the scientific world. Another name is ASA plastic (international name ASA), and in the BASF concern this polymer is called in its own way - Luran S. It is clear that the siding is called acrylic, and not acrylic-styrene-acrylonitrile, for good reason, since sellers would have to develop diction, articulation and eloquence, and potential buyers would immediately be afraid of a tricky name.

ASA plastic is a thermoplastic polymer, and its melting and polymerization temperature is approximately the same as PVC. This allows, by co-extrusion, to make compositions of PVC and ACA polymer bonded at the molecular level. What this gives, we will consider below.

What are the properties of thermoplastic ACA copolymer (hereinafter referred to as acrylic)? Why can it be used for siding?

  • Acrylic has high rigidity, hardness and impact resistance.
  • Acrylic retains its strength at temperatures up to 80-90°C, perfectly withstands short-term heating up to 100-110°C. When heated, unlike vinyl, acrylic does not emit any volatile compounds. It has virtually no odor.
  • Acrylic products withstand low temperatures well. Acrylic becomes brittle only at temperatures from -25°C to -40°C (depending on the presence and amount of antifreeze additives).
  • Acrylic is resistant to water, acids, diesel fuel, mineral oils. Detergents can be used to care for the acrylic coating.
  • Acrylic has a density lower than that of PVC, it is in the range of 1.06-1.10 g / cm³.
  • Acrylic has excellent biological resistance, fungi or mold will never settle on its surface.
  • One of the main properties of the ACA copolymer is its resistance to ultraviolet radiation; it does not cause photodegradation. Thanks to this, acrylic can be painted in different, even bright colors that will not fade over time. In addition, opaque acrylic is a reliable barrier to ultraviolet light photons.
  • Acrylic is very easy to process and recycle without emitting toxic gases, as is the case with vinyl. When processed, recycled acrylic practically does not lose its properties.

The combination of these properties determines the widespread use of the ACA copolymer. It is used to make exterior plastic parts for cars, housings for household appliances, sports equipment, details of sea and river vessels, toys, plumbing items and other things. In the recent past, siding has also been made. Obtaining acrylic in the form of an ACA copolymer is a complex and expensive technological operation, which is not available to all chemical concerns. Therefore, this material is much more expensive than PVC. This is its disadvantage. Perhaps the only one.

The most famous manufacturers of ACA copolymer (acrylic) are:

  • Saudi Arabian company SABIC produces an ASA copolymer under the brand name Geloy ASA.
  • LG Chemicals of South Korea manufactures this material under the name LG ASA.
  • BASF in Germany produces an ACA copolymer called Luran S.

All manufacturers of quality acrylic siding purchase raw materials mainly from these companies, as they are of excellent quality.

What is acrylic siding

Now we offer, together with readers, to understand such a concept as acrylic siding. And the first thing I want to say is that 100% acrylic siding simply does not exist. If there was such a thing, it would cost such fabulous money that no one would pay attention to it. Let's take an example. One of the best manufacturers siding is the Canadian company Mitten, which gives a 50-year written guarantee for its siding, provided that original components are used. They report absolutely honestly about their siding on their official website, calling it vinyl. True, in the description of their Sentry Mitten collection, which has the richest color gamut, it is indicated that the thickness of the panel is increased to 1.2 mm, and Acrylic Color Technology (a.c.t.) is used for color stabilization and management. That is, acrylic is mentioned, and it is used specifically for coloring and ensuring color fastness. But there is not a single word that the siding is acrylic.

Now let's take one of the leading Russian siding manufacturers - Tecos. In particular, the siding from the Tecos - Ardennes collection, which has the most intense color palette. What is written in the description of this collection on the official website (quote): “Please note that products in Arabica and Burgundy colors are produced using an acrylic polymer, which has a maximum a high degree resistance to ultraviolet rays and, thanks to this, additionally protects the color from fading. By the way, we forgot to inform you that this refers to the section of the site "PVC siding panels". There is simply no such thing as acrylic siding.

If you enter the query “Tecos acrylic siding” in any search engine (any other is possible), then in a fraction of a second an impressive list of sellers will be displayed, who, without any twinge of conscience, in the description of the product of this respected manufacturer, indicate acrylic in the “material” column. And this despite the fact that the manufacturer gave very correct information about his product. And unfortunately, a lot of sellers sin with such a violation as providing deliberately false information about a product. We decided to go further and find at least one certificate of conformity on the Internet, which would indicate that the siding is acrylic or ASA copolymer. And none were found. Where sellers proudly state that the siding is acrylic and there is a link to certificates, these documents state the following: “PVC wall panels of the Siding type, or just PVC siding. And nothing more.

The manufacturer's website states that this is acrylic siding, and the certificate of conformity says PVC siding. Who to believe?

It turns out that the statement that the siding is completely acrylic is not entirely correct? In other words, are the sellers lying? Yes, in fact it is. But we do not want to upset the readers of our portal and hasten to reassure that the ACA copolymer is really used in the production of colored siding as an outer layer. High-quality siding is painted throughout, including the outer acrylic layer, which itself does not fade under the influence of ultraviolet radiation, and also prevents its penetration into deeper layers. A thin outer layer of painted acrylic is enough to look presentable for decades and protect the full thickness of the panel. Therefore, a good manufacturer pursues a very noble goal - to save the buyer's money. And the name "acrylic" is a marketing ploy of sellers that does not detract from the merits of vinyl siding with an acrylic front layer.

How is acrylic siding produced? Given that both PVC and ACA copolymer are thermoplastic plastics, there is no fundamental difference in their extrusion. The outer layer is acrylic and the inner layer is vinyl. They are connected by co-extrusion, which makes the panel almost monolithic, which under no circumstances will delaminate. What links are included in the technological chain of siding production?

  1. Raw materials (acrylic and vinyl) are melted, each in its own bunker. This is to ensure that the components do not mix until the sheets are formed. Yes and temperature regime one polymer may be slightly different from another.
  2. Dyes are introduced into the melts with special dispensers. In high-quality siding, coloring goes throughout the volume, so dyes are added to both PVC and acrylic. At the same stage, other components are introduced into the composition in strict accordance with the technology.
  3. The melt of compounds (thermoplastics) with the help of screws is fed to slotted dies, and PVC has its own die, and ACA copolymer has its own. The dies have strictly calibrated holes, so the sheets come out of the desired thickness. The spinnerets are positioned so that after the formation of the canvases it is possible to lay them one on top of the other while not completely cooled down. This is done in order to different materials securely "sintered" with each other.

  1. Next, the already formed two-layer canvas, which has not yet been completely cooled, must be given the desired texture and profile. To do this, the canvas first passes through rollers, forming the texture, and then fed into the sizing mill, where the profile of the future siding is formed. This is done using shafts of the desired shape. The process of rolling through the shafts always goes with lubrication of their surface so as not to damage the workpiece.
  2. The final stage is cutting holes for fasteners and draining condensate, and then cutting a continuous web into segments of the desired size.

The table shows that more technologically advanced siding - with an acrylic front layer, is significantly more expensive. And its main advantage is that there is no photodestruction of the upper layer. Otherwise, the characteristics are very similar in many respects. So is it worth spending extra money when you can get by with a cheaper option? Our set of recommendations will be as follows:

  • Both manufacturers and designers recommend using siding in soft pastel colors for home decoration. Such cladding will not get bored for a long time and the gradual photodestruction, which is expressed in the appearance of whitishness, will be almost imperceptible. It is known that pastel colors are obtained by adding white to some color. The burnout process is just manifested in the addition white color. In this case, the choice should be unequivocal - high-quality vinyl siding from a good manufacturer.
  • If the owners decide to use siding in dark colors and rich shades in the decoration and want the facade not to fade for a long time, then, of course, the choice should be in favor of siding with an acrylic coating of the front layer. True, at the same time it is necessary to measure the choice with your financial capabilities. The choice should also be only in favor of well-known manufacturers.
  • If the house that needs to be lined with siding is located in the southern latitudes and is located in a place constantly illuminated by the sun, then the choice in favor of acrylic siding will be fully justified.
  • If the siding is to be washed frequently using household chemicals, then siding with an acrylic front layer will respond better to this. This may be in those regions where there is a large amount of dust and soot in the air due to natural causes or the location of some industrial facilities nearby.
  • It happens that when facing houses, they make a combination of siding from light and dark tones to highlight architectural elements and emphasize uniqueness. Then you can buy vinyl siding in light colors, and acrylic siding for dark colors.

Ways to identify low-quality material

To choose a siding that will meet all the requirements for finishing materials for cladding houses, you should know the basic selection criteria. The main attention should be paid to the inspection of the following parts and parameters of siding panels:

  • The presence of uniformity of the color of the material. Unevenly colored material fades in the sun and quickly changes color.
  • The same thickness of the panel along the entire length.
  • Qualitatively executed nail holes on siding panels.
  • Correctly executed front surface with resistance to UV rays matte color which does not fade in the sun.
  • The material should have a uniform color and high-quality plasticity, and during the bend test, the material should not break off.


A responsible manufacturer always accompanies its products with installation instructions. In addition, it should be remembered that increasing the thickness of the siding panels does not improve its quality. Optimal parameters this indicator does not exceed 1.2 mm.

An increase in thickness provokes a loss of elasticity of the material, which will ultimately have a negative impact on the finish's resistance to impacts and discoloration. AT winter period such panels are hard to "shrink" and as a result of temperature changes, the risk of cracking and discoloration increases. Manufacturing technology

Vinyl siding was originally designed and manufactured in North America, the US and Canada for over 50 years. Behind long years technology has changed a lot, and it's safe to say that siding manufacturers from the United States and Canada make the highest quality products. However, prices for foreign materials are more expensive than domestic counterparts, so it is worth considering this option for purchasing products.

Vinyl siding is produced by extrusion. This means that the molten vinyl powder is forced through special holes into the mould. After the vinyl cools, it retains its shape, it is removed from the extruder, then cut to the specified dimensions and given a working profile.

The production technology is divided into two types:

  • Monoextrusion;
  • Co-extrusion.

With mono-extrusion production, the composition of the siding is uniform, all additives in it are distributed equally, and do not take into account the properties of the outer and inner sides of the panel. Today, this method is practically not used, as it is considered obsolete.

The co-extrusion production method is more advanced and requires the use of expensive equipment. Its essence lies in the fact that the first layer is 15-25% of the thickness of the panel, it contains a dye to give color and additives to protect against environmental conditions. The inner layer is much thicker and has a different composition that allows the siding to retain its shape for many years.

Through the use of this technology, optimal material price, strength and durability.

The thickness of the panels is determined by the standard set by the American Society for Testing Materials and should be between 0.9 and 1.2 mm. If you want the facade to serve you for more than 10 years, then it is recommended to use a siding thickness of at least 1.1 mm.

Note!
Often, the low price of siding can be at the expense of its quality.
Manufacturers, in pursuit of cost reduction, use recycled products (more than 4%), which are obtained from old doors and plastic windows, to make the second layer.
Sometimes such siding is called "Grey-back".
Some manage to use up to 80% of secondary products, which naturally significantly reduces the characteristics of the material.
At the same time, the appearance and strength of the siding, as well as its resistance to climatic influences, suffer.

Does siding burn out?

The main question that torments many buyers is whether siding burns out in the sun? Our answer: Yes, it will fade like any other painted material. Titanium dioxide is responsible for color retention, which is added to the composition of the top layer and protects the pigments from ultraviolet rays.

This is the difference between cheap and quality siding. Most quality species will begin to burn out in 10 years, many Russian ones after 5 years, and the cheapest after 1-2 years. So if you are making a house for yourself, then it is better not to save on facing materials.

Metal siding: features

Metal siding has high performance properties. The service life of the panels is 25-50 years, of which about 15 years without color fading, but this applies to high-quality materials.

Metal panels have better fire resistance and a much higher melting point than acrylic and vinyl siding. Of the positive qualities, strength, impact resistance, resistance to deformation, and fire safety are actively distinguished.

Metal siding is used for residential buildings, industrial buildings, fences. For residential buildings, it is better to use panels with imitation of a wooden or stone surface.

Of the disadvantages, the weight of metal siding should be noted - it is much heavier than polymer plates. In addition, metal panels are quite expensive. The thermal insulation of a house sheathed with metal siding is defective. Metal siding is still more suitable for cladding industrial buildings, providing protection from it. According to customer reviews, metal plates are prone to corrosion when scratched and chipped.

Features of using siding for sheathing a wooden house

Wooden houses from a log house, although they have an initially attractive appearance, are strongly affected by precipitation. The wood turns black, mold and rottenness may appear. Siding provides protection to the home and performs a decorative function.

Wooden houses often turn out to be cold, so a layer of insulation can be laid under the siding. In addition, it is recommended to apply a layer of waterproofing and vapor barrier to prevent the formation of mold and prevent rotting of the walls. Thus, it is possible to increase the life of the building.

for sheathing wooden house Vinyl siding is best. The most popular - with imitation natural materials. Vinyl siding for cladding a wooden house is insensitive to moisture, not prone to bacterial growth and decay, and is environmentally friendly.

To finish the walls with siding, it is necessary to install a rack frame on outer walls Houses. Bars for crates are recommended to be processed special solution to prevent wood decay.

Advice. As a frame, it is better to use not wooden bars, but a galvanized profile. Such a crate is more reliable and not prone to deformation under the influence of humidity and temperature. Also, you should not attach the siding directly to the wall, because wooden house shrinks over time.
